Dr Screen
- Address
- 821 Sw 29th St
- Place
- Cape Coral , FL 33914
- Landline
- (239) 772-2242
Description
Dr Screen can be found at 821 Sw 29th St . The following is offered: Doors & Windows - In Cape Coral there are 30 other Doors & Windows. An overview can be found here.
Reviews
This listing was not reviewed yet
Categories
Doors & Windows(239)772-2242 (239)-772-2242 +12397722242